> > > swscale: use 16-bit intermediate precision for RGB/XYZ conversion
> > > 
> > > The current logic uses 12-bit linear light math, which is woefully insufficient
> > > and leads to nasty postarization artifacts. This patch simply switches the
> > > internal logic to 16-bit precision.
> > > 
> > > This raises the memory requirement of these tables from 32 kB to 272 kB.
> > > 
> > > All relevant FATE tests updated for improved accuracy.
